Review:

4 stars

****

Aww! This was really sweet and cute. Mr. Stone is a standalone novella by Sarah Curtis. Emma works for Mr. Slone (Damon). He is a tough, strict and cold boss. So much stone that she has secretly nicknamed him Mr. Stone. But one night, a disaster strikes and the two of them are trapped in their office during an earthquake. That's when the fun starts and they really get to know each other (and find out how perfect for each other they are). I liked this novella a lot. Iy was a fun, quick and easy read. The story was cute and unique. I really liked Emma and Damon together. Overall, Mr. Stone was an emtertaining and enjoyable read!

Review:

4-4.25 stars
****

 This was really good! It Happened One Summer is Brendan and Piper's story. Piper is the daughter of Hollywood royalty and is a spoiled LA princess and It girl. After a breakup, she goes a little wild and gets herself arrested. After she is released, her stepfather sends her and her sister out of town for the summer to get them out of the limelight. Piper, and her sister, Hannah, have never left LA and are in culture shock when they arrive in the small town in Washington. Their birth father, who died when they were very young, was from there and was a sea fisherman and bar owner. Piper and Hannah are in for an adventure as they learn to do brand new things like cook for themselves, while surviving in the sticks. They get to know the townpeople and decide to fix up their father's run down bar. Piper meets Brendan, a widowed fisherman, and opposites attract when the two of them fall for each other. They have to figure out how to make things work between them and how they can be together, despite coming from two different worlds.

This was a fun story with the perfect balance of emotion and humor. I am not a Schitt's Creek fan. I just couldn't get into it. So I was a bit wary that I wouldn't love this book, or Piper, who is based on Alexis Rose. But that wasn't the case. Piper does come off a bit silly at first, but I ended up really liking her as I got to know her. She is a good person with heart. She and Brendan were awesome together. Brendan was such a good hero. He worshipped Piper and she loved him very much as well. This book was the "dead ex" trope done right. It was no contest between Brendan's love for Piper. He was consumed by her, while his dead wife was more of a marriage of convenience.

It Happened One Summer was such a good story. It was unique, fun, and super sexy. The cartoon cover was not my favorite at all. It really did not fit the story and doesn't not give prospective readers a true picture of the story they are about to read. Despite that, this book had it all. Really good characters, a great story, depth and chemistry. The small town fishing village setting was fun and different. It was really great seeing Piper grow and come into her own and seeing Brendan open up and fall in love. The two of them were awesome together.

Overall, this was a great book. I really enjoyed Piper and Brendan's story. I can't wait to read Hannah's story in the future and see what Ms. Bailey comes up with next!

Review:
4.5 stars
****
This book was so good! Near perfection. I'm going to gush a bit over this one, so be warned. Exposed is Brenna and Rye's story. The two of them have had some tension in the previous books, but, in this book, we find out what their history is and why they act the way they do around each other. Rye is a famous music and in the band Kill John. Brenna is the manager of the band and one of the member's cousin. They grew up together and have had a love/hate relationship with each other over the years. Things between them are complicated and they have a lot of history, but everything comes to a head in the present. It is now time for them to work things out and become who they are really meant to be together.

Exposed was an amazing book. I never give 5 stars, but this was nearly there. I only didn't go higher because I couldn't identify with Brenna quite as much as some other heroines. Still, this was a superb read. It was so romantic, sweet and sexy with amazing chemistry and connection between the couple. The pacing was perfect and the writing was truly stellar. I loved Rye and Brenna together. Their complicated history spans years, but they were meant to be together. Rye was a doll. I loved him and the way he adored Brenna. I liked Brenna as well. She was strong and independant on the outside, but not as much on the inside. I was so happy that they worked everything out between them so that they could be happy with each other. The two of them could be themselves, let their guard down and really knew each other like no one else knew them. I did want a little more of a glimpse into their day to day lives together in the future. But, still, this was an amazing read.

Overall, I loved this book. I have really enjoyed this series and find the books keep getting better and better. They're all really great reads and I can't wait to read Whip's story in the future. I look forward to more from Ms. Callihan!

Review:

3.5-3.75 stars

***

 I liked this book! Pause is book two in the Larsen Brothers series by Kylie Scott. This is Leif, the brother of the hero in Repeat, and Anna's book. Anna is in a hit and run car accident. Leif happens upon the accident and helps save her life. After the accident, Anna is in a coma for a while. When she wakes up, she finds out her husband and her best friend are now together. Anna has to figure out how to rebuild her new life, without her old marriage or her old job. Her new friend, Leif, helps her get back on her feet and romance blossoms.

This was a good story. Anna and Leif were cute together. Their romance is slow burn and they didn't oficially get together until close to the end. I wanted them to get together a bit sooner. Anna was a worrier and got in her own head a lot. Leif was a laid back, flirty, funny and charming guy but he didn't do any of the chasing. He let Anna lead, which made sense because of everything she had been through, but I still wanted a bit more "take charge-ness" out of him to help settle her worries. Still, they were a fun couple and I liked them. I didn't feel a ton of chemistry, nor did the story cause me to feel a lot of deep emotions. But Pause was a very entertaining, fun, enjoyable and easy read.

Overall, I enjoyed Leif and Anna's story. I was happy they worked everything out between them and got the HEA they deserved. I am enjoying this series and I hope this is not the end. I look forward to what comes next from Ms. Scott!

Review:

3.5-3.75 stars
***


 This was a good book. Fortunate Son has the charm of the Marked Men series and has so many possibilities for more great stories about the now-grown children of the original characters. This is Ry and Bowe's book. Ry and Bowe have a complicated history as childhood friends that ended badly in their teens and they haven't spoken since. Ry is now a college football player and Bowe lives in Austin and is an aspiring singer. When Ry's girlfriend breaks up with him, saying they aren't a good match, he can't explain why he immediately runs to Bowe. Despite their differences they understand each other like no one else does and now the time has come for them to work out their issues and be together.

I enjoyed this story a lot and being back in the Marked Men world. All of the kids of the original characters are close friends and complicated relationships with each other. The first 75% of the book was my favorite. I did feel like it lost a bit of relationship momentum and fizzled out at the end. I didn't feel like they had really worked out everything between them and some important conversations were skipped over. I wasn't super satisfied with where they ended up. Still, this was an enjoyable book in general. This world was so much potential and I really hope Ms. Crownover continues this as a series.

Review:

3.75 stars

***+

 This was good! Treasured is a novella in the Masters and Mercenaries series and is Tessa and David's (Sean Taggart's stepson/Grace's son/Kyle's brother) book. David is a college professor who is writing a book about an eccentric millionaire in South America who died and left a treasure hidden in the South American jungle. Tessa works for McKay Taggart as a bodyguard. She meets David by chance, not knowing who each other are really, at the bar at Top. They have a connection, talk for hours and share a kiss, making plans for a date later. But Tessa finds out who he is and doesn't want to get involved with someone related to the Taggarts and her work. So she ghosts him. But when there are threats to David's safety on his research trip to South America, Tessa is assigned as his bodyguard. The two both have some baggage from family situations and past relationships, but they manage to work things out between them, fall in love and stick together through a dangerous situation.

Treasured was a good read. It is a novella, but it felt plenty long enough to have a detailed romance. I really liked the hot professor, David, and the fact that Tessa could hold her own as a bodyguard, but was willing to be vulnerable and submit to him in the bedroom. They were a great match. I also liked the tropical location and treasure hunt aspect. This was an entertaining, well written story and an easy read. Overall, I enjoyed Treasured and I look forward to more from Ms. Blake and one of my favorite series!
